T45687: Rework the Export/Import of Animations
This started with a fix for an animated Object Hierarchy. Then i decided to cleanup and optimize a bit. But at the end this has become a more or less full rewrite of the Animation Exporter. All of this happened in a separate local branch and i have retained all my local commits to better see what i have done. Brief description: * I fixed a few issues with exporting keyframed animations of object hierarchies where the objects have parent inverse matrices which differ from the Identity matrix. * I added the option to export sampled animations with a user defined sampling rate (new user interface option) * I briefly tested Object Animations and Rig Animations. What is still needed: * Cleanup the code * Optimize the user interface * Do the Documentation Reviewers: mont29 Reviewed By: mont29 Differential Revision: https://developer.blender.org/D3070
